Quick Facts
Best Time to Visit
Dublin's highest average temperatures occur in July and August.
Language
English is the primary language spoken in Dublin, with Irish also having official status.
Currency
The official currency used in Dublin is the Euro (€).
Visa Info
Visa requirements for entering Dublin depend on the traveler's nationality and purpose of stay.
Plug Type
Dublin uses Type G electrical plugs with a standard voltage of 230V.
Time zone
Dublin operates on Irish Standard Time (IST) in summer and Greenwich Mean Time (GMT) in winter.
